Buchanan Dam enjoys a temperate climate with an average annual temperature of 65°F (18°C). Winters average 47°F in January while summers reach 83°F in July. The area gets 303 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 32.3 inches. The area receives 0.1 inches of snow annually.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 42.

Monthly Weather
| Month | Avg Temperature | Precipitation | Summary |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 47°F (8°C) | 1.4 in | Coldest, Driest |
| February | 51°F (11°C) | 2.0 in | |
| March | 59°F (15°C) | 2.0 in | |
| April | 66°F (19°C) | 2.4 in | |
| May | 73°F (23°C) | 4.4 in | Wettest |
| June | 80°F (26°C) | 3.2 in | |
| July | 83°F (28°C) | 1.8 in | Warmest |
| August | 83°F (28°C) | 2.1 in | |
| September | 77°F (25°C) | 3.0 in | |
| October | 68°F (20°C) | 3.2 in | |
| November | 57°F (14°C) | 2.1 in | |
| December | 49°F (10°C) | 1.6 in |
Buchanan Dam has a seasonal temperature swing of 36°F / from 47°F in January to 83°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 29.0 inches, with May being the wettest month (4.4") and January the driest (1.4").
